  "account": "Thane Municipal Corporation (TMC) has announced a full waiver of penalties and interest on pending domestic water bills for residential consumers. This generous amnesty scheme will be in effect from September 1, 2026, to December 31, 2026. TMC Mayor Sharmila Pimplolkar and Municipal Commissioner Saurabh Rao have jointly encouraged residents to take advantage of this limited-time offer.\n\nTo be eligible for the complete penalty waiver, domestic tap connection holders must pay off all outstanding water dues and the full amount for the current financial year (2026-27) in one lump sum payment. If residents fail to settle their bills by the December 31, 2026 deadline, their water connections will be cut off starting January 1, 2027.\n\nThe TMC administration has stressed that this incentive is exclusively for residential property owners and will not be extended to commercial water consumers. Failure to clear outstanding dues by the end of the year will result in immediate disconnection of water supply. Municipal authorities are urging eligible citizens to settle their bills promptly before the deadline to ensure uninterrupted access to this essential service.",
